Output 21fb08586f331f72f65cd6dfb93836d5b0d1a4f68fce05a15e900a504df42d68:0
- value
- 666000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 243d3c16b3a386e130b208296e214387dc8aace7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14JcgZzsYGjPqkaqX1VUs13KdvnaSCUvAN
- transaction
- 21fb08586f331f72f65cd6dfb93836d5b0d1a4f68fce05a15e900a504df42d68